Implementation of a High Throughput Soft MIMO Detector on GPU

被引:0
|
作者
Michael Wu
Yang Sun
Siddharth Gupta
Joseph R. Cavallaro
机构
[1] Rice University,Electrical and Computer Engineering
来源
关键词
GPU; Soft output detection; MIMO; Wireless baseband architecture;
D O I
暂无
中图分类号
学科分类号
摘要
Multiple-input multiple-output (MIMO) significantly increases the throughput of a communication system by employing multiple antennas at the transmitter and the receiver. To extract maximum performance from a MIMO system, a computationally intensive search based detector is needed. To meet the challenge of MIMO detection, typical suboptimal MIMO detectors are ASIC or FPGA designs. We aim to show that a MIMO detector on Graphic processor unit (GPU), a low-cost parallel programmable co-processor, can achieve high throughput and can serve as an alternative to ASIC/FPGA designs. However, careful architecture aware software design is needed to leverage the performance offered by GPU. We propose a novel soft MIMO detection algorithm, multi-pass trellis traversal (MTT), and show that we can achieve ASIC/FPGA-like performance and handle different configurations in software on GPU. The proposed design can be used to accelerate wireless physical layer simulations and to offload MIMO detection processing in wireless testbed platforms.
引用
收藏
页码:123 / 136
页数:13
相关论文
共 50 条
  • [41] New Parallel Sphere Detector algorithm providing high-throughput for optimal MIMO detection
    Jozsa, Csaba M.
    Kolumban, Geza
    Vidal, Antonio M.
    Martinez-Zaldivar, Francisco-Jose
    Gonzalez, Alberto
    2013 INTERNATIONAL CONFERENCE ON COMPUTATIONAL SCIENCE, 2013, 18 : 2432 - 2435
  • [42] Gram-Schmidt tailed High-throughput QR Decomposition Architecture for MIMO detector
    Shin, Dongyeob
    Yoon, Ji-Hwan
    Park, Jongsun
    Choi, Woong
    2014 INTERNATIONAL SOC DESIGN CONFERENCE (ISOCC), 2014, : 264 - 265
  • [43] An Efficient Soft Output MIMO Detector Architecture Considering High-order Modulations
    Dai, Ya-Xin
    Jhang, Shih-Jie
    Chen, Yen-Ming
    Lan, Sheng-Ping
    Ueng, Yeong-Luh
    2022 56TH ASILOMAR CONFERENCE ON SIGNALS, SYSTEMS, AND COMPUTERS, 2022, : 623 - 627
  • [44] Design and implementation of a high-throughput configurable pre-processor for MIMO detections
    Tseng, Tzu-Ting
    Shen, Chung-An
    MICROELECTRONICS JOURNAL, 2018, 72 : 14 - 23
  • [45] Design and Implementation of a Throughput-Optimized GPU Floorplanning Algorithm
    Han, Yiding
    Chakraborty, Koushik
    Roy, Sanghamitra
    Kuntamukkala, Vilasita
    ACM TRANSACTIONS ON DESIGN AUTOMATION OF ELECTRONIC SYSTEMS, 2011, 16 (03)
  • [46] High Throughput Software Multithreshold Decoder on GPU
    Zolotarev, V
    Ovechkin, G.
    Ovechkin, P.
    Satybaldina, D.
    Tashatov, N.
    Sankibayev, D.
    PROCEEDINGS OF THE 3RD INTERNATIONAL CONFERENCE ON MATHEMATICS AND COMPUTERS IN SCIENCES AND IN INDUSTRY (MCSI 2016), 2016, : 168 - 171
  • [47] A High-Throughput VLSI Architecture for Hard and Soft SC-FDMA MIMO Detectors
    Neshatpour, Katayoun
    Shabany, Mahdi
    Gulak, Glenn
    IEEE TRANSACTIONS ON CIRCUITS AND SYSTEMS I-REGULAR PAPERS, 2015, 62 (03) : 761 - 770
  • [48] High Throughput Implementation of Post-Quantum Key Encapsulation and Decapsulation on GPU for Internet of Things Applications
    Lee, Wai-Kong
    Hwang, Seong Oun
    IEEE TRANSACTIONS ON SERVICES COMPUTING, 2022, 15 (06) : 3275 - 3288
  • [49] An Implementation of GSG with Parallel Outputs targeting MIMO Detector
    Hwang, Soo Yun
    Park, Gi Yoon
    Park, Hyeong Jun
    Jhang, Kyoung Son
    68TH IEEE VEHICULAR TECHNOLOGY CONFERENCE, FALL 2008, 2008, : 935 - 939
  • [50] Implementation of a Belief Propagation Detector for an Iterative MIMO Receiver
    Haroun, Ali
    Rashid, Ahmed R.
    Haydar, Jamal
    2018 19TH INTERNATIONAL ARAB CONFERENCE ON INFORMATION TECHNOLOGY (ACIT), 2018, : 230 - 235